Data Entry Keyers Salary
The median pay for a data entry keyers in Mayaguez, PR is $23,420/year ($11.26/hour), per BLS data. The range runs from $22K at the entry level to $34K for experienced workers. Adjusted for local prices (RPP 100), that's roughly $23,420 in purchasing power. A 2-bedroom apartment runs $530/month, about 31.8% of take-home, which is tight.

What this looks like in Mayaguez
Pay for data entry keyers in Mayaguez runs about 43% below the U.S. median of $41K. Rent runs $530/month for a 2-bedroom (HUD FMR), taking 30.6% of the median take-home. That's within the 30% rule, though not by much. Cost of living (RPP 100) is near the national average, so spending patterns here track the typical American budget fairly closely. Frequently asked questions
Can a data entry keyer afford a 2BR apartment alone in Mayaguez?
It’s a stretch — at the median salary of $23K, rent takes 30.6% of take-home pay. A 2-bedroom at the HUD Fair Market Rent runs $530/month. The 30% guideline puts the comfortable ceiling at roughly $500/month in rent — so roommates or a 1-bedroom would ease the math significantly.
What’s the entry-level salary for data entry keyers in Mayaguez?
The 10th-percentile wage — what new data entry keyers typically earn — is $22K/year. Take-home on that works out to about $1,310/month. At HUD’s $530/month FMR, rent would take 40% of that take-home — above the 30% guideline, so a 1-bedroom or shared housing is likely necessary starting out.

How much do data entry keyers make in Mayaguez, PR?
The median is $23,420 a year, that works out to about $11 an hour. But the range is wide: entry-level workers start around $21,840, and experienced data entry keyers can clear $34,420. These are BLS numbers, based on employer-reported data, not self-reported surveys.
